 FreeBSD6.2/NTFS3G/Windows XP problem
Hello,
Files created with NTFS-3G under FreeBSD6.2 on a NTFS partition are not visible under Windows XP.
For windows xp, they don't exist, while file is OK on freebsd.
Any suggestions on how to produce a valuable debug?

There isn't any diference between external, internal drives, file images, etc from ntfs-3g point of view. It absolutely most defintely doesn't matter.
In case of an external drive, if data weren't synched to disk and unmounted properly before detachment from the computer or during shutdown then data loss could happen of course.
